      Album Details

      Enzo Favata's "Islà," released on January 1, 1995, under the Felmay label, is a captivating blend of Jazz, Folk, and World music that showcases the unique fusion of traditional and modern sounds. This album, recorded with the collaboration of Federico Sanesi, Marcello Peghin, and Riccardo, among others, is a testament to Favata's versatility and innovative spirit. The ten tracks, ranging from the energetic "Burkina" to the introspective "Così vicino...così lontano," offer a rich tapestry of musical styles and influences. Each song is a journey through different cultures and landscapes, with "Pane arabo" and "Ramblas" highlighting the Mediterranean and Middle Eastern influences that Favata masterfully weaves into his compositions. "Islà" is not just an album but a collection of stories told through music, each track offering a glimpse into the diverse musical heritage that inspires Enzo Favata. The album's duration of one hour ensures a comprehensive experience, making it a standout piece in Favata's discography and a must-listen for fans of world music.

      About Enzo Favata

      Enzo Favata, born in 1956 in Alghero, Sardinia, is a renowned Italian saxophonist and a prominent figure in the international jazz scene. Known for his versatility, Favata masterfully plays the soprano sax, bass clarinet, and incorporates electronics into his music, creating a unique and captivating sound. With a career spanning decades, he has become one of the most active and celebrated Sardinian musicians, both in Italy and abroad. His discography is rich and diverse, featuring albums like "Made In Sardinia" and "Voyage En Sardaigne," which showcase his ability to blend traditional and modern elements. Favata's top tracks, such as "Salt Way" and "Milonga Del Sol," highlight his innovative approach to jazz, making him a must-listen for any fan of the genre.
